Get Price3. Carbon-In-Leach (CIL) The carbon-in-leach process integrates leaching and carbon-in-pulp into a single unit process operation. Leach tanks are fitted with carbon retention screens and the CIP tanks are eliminated. Carbon is added in leach so that the gold is adsorbed onto carbon almost as soon as it is dissolved by the cyanide solution.
Get PriceTank leaching explained. In metallurgical processes tank leaching is a hydrometallurgical method of extracting valuable material (usually metals) from ore.. Tank vs. vat leaching Factors. Tank leaching is usually differentiated from vat leaching on the following factors In tank leaching the material is ground sufficiently fine to form a slurry or pulp, which can flow under gravity or when pumped.
Get PriceHeap leaching can take anything from a couple of months to several years. In the case of gold recovery, heap leaching generally requires 60 to 90 days to leach the ore, compared to the 24 hours required by a conventional agitated leach process. Gold recovery is also usually only 70% compared with 90% recovery in an agitated leach plant.

Get Priceremoved from the "pregnant" leach solution by chemical precipitation or another chemical or electrochemical process. Leaching methods include "dump," heap," and "tank" operations. Heap leaching is widely used in the gold industry, and dump leaching in the copper industry. "Beneficiation of copper consists of crushing

In dump leaching, which is used primarily for low-grade copper ore, the material to be treated is placed on unlined foundations (i.e., directly on the ground). The leaching chemical solution typically is sulfuric acid but sometimes is water.

Get PriceHeap leaching takes months rather than years as for dump leaching. Compared to stirred tank reactors, heap reactors form undesired gradients of pH and reagent levels. The reaction conditions in a heap varies from top to bottom, from core to surface and sometimes also locally in the heap.

Get PriceA slurry of ground ore, water and a weak cyanide solution is fed into large steel leach tanks where the gold and silver are dissolved. Following this leaching process the slurry passes through six adsorption tanks containing carbon granules which adsorb the gold and silver. This process removes 93% of the gold and 70% of the silver.
